If we have a set E with two relation * and + : (E,+,*)
we say that the relation * is distributive with respect to the relation
If a*(b+c) = a*b + a*c for every a,b,c from E</span>

Answer:
720 Course Schedules
Step-by-step explanation:
When you choose the first course, there are 6 to choose from. When you scoose the second, there are only 5. This keeps going until the 6th course where there is only 1 choice.
You multiply these choices together. You should get 6×5×4×3×2×1
6×5=30
30×4=120
120×3=360
360×2=720
720×1=720
You then end up with 720 course schedules.
